Interpersonal relationships: The relationships that a person has with others, such as family, friends, and romantic partners, can play a significant role in shaping their sense of identity. These relationships can provide validation, support, and acceptance, or conversely, rejection and criticism.
Personal beliefs and values: A person’s beliefs and values can also contribute to their sense of identity. This includes their beliefs about their purpose in life, their personal goals, and their moral and ethical principles.
Biological factors: Certain biological factors, such as genetics and brain chemistry, can influence a person’s personality traits, behaviors, and emotions, which in turn can shape their sense of identity.
Overall, a person’s sense of identity is a complex and dynamic construct that is shaped by a combination of factors throughout their life. Understanding these factors can help individuals to develop a stronger sense of self and navigate their way through life with greater confidence and purpose.
